They say that art imitates life,Poland but in this case they definitely got it the wrong way round.

On Sunday night, a multitude of Hollywood stars walked the red carpet for the Golden Globes. E's live feed was there to capture it all.

When The Good Placestar Jameela Jamil arrived, though, people noticed something a little strange.

Yep: someone captioned Jamil with the name Kamilah Al-Jamil, which is actually the name of her Good Placecharacter Tahani's sister (played by Rebecca Hazlewood) -- the same sister who is constantly one-upping Tahani in the show.

Whether it was a simple mistake or a fairly genius piece of meta comedy is unclear -- but either way, the caption seemed to go down a treat.

E!'s red carpet team later corrected themselves, clarifying on air that they did in fact know Jamil's name.
